Có hai cách bạn có thể chuyển đổi văn bản thành chữ hoa trong Word, trong một macro. Đầu tiên là sử dụng thuộc tính AllCaps và thứ hai là sử dụng thuộc tính Case. Sau đây là cách sử dụng cả hai phương pháp.

Selection.Font.AllCaps = True Selection.Range.Case = wdUpperCase

Cả hai câu lệnh này giả sử bạn đã chọn văn bản cần thay đổi trước khi phát hành các câu lệnh. Sự khác biệt giữa chúng là thuộc tính AllCaps chỉ kiểm soát định dạng của văn bản — nó chỉ xuất hiện dưới dạng chữ hoa. Mặt khác, thuộc tính Case thực sự thay đổi các chữ cái trong vùng chọn để chúng là chữ hoa.

_Lưu ý: _

Nếu bạn muốn biết cách sử dụng các macro được mô tả trên trang này (hoặc trên bất kỳ trang nào khác trên các trang WordTips), tôi đã chuẩn bị một trang đặc biệt bao gồm thông tin hữu ích.

WordTips là nguồn của bạn để đào tạo Microsoft Word hiệu quả về chi phí.

(Microsoft Word là phần mềm xử lý văn bản phổ biến nhất trên thế giới.) Mẹo này (9354) áp dụng cho Microsoft Word 2007, 2010, 2013, 2016, 2019 và Word trong Office 365. Bạn có thể tìm thấy phiên bản của mẹo này cho giao diện menu cũ hơn của Word tại đây: